What Does the placard Emoji 🪧 Mean?

A handheld protest sign mounted on a wooden stick — blank and ready for any message. Added in Unicode 14.0 (2021), the placard emoji represents protest, activism, advocacy, and public demonstration. People use it in posts about marches, rallies, climate protests, labor strikes, and political demonstrations.

It's a workhorse for hashtag activism and 'in the streets' content. It also gets used metaphorically — 'this is my placard for the day 🪧' — to signal a cause or principle. Picket lines and union strike posts use it heavily.

It can also represent signage at events, picket signs at workplaces, or even ironic 'protesting Monday 🪧' humor. Whether the cause is climate, labor rights, civil rights, or just a friend protesting bad office coffee, this little sign is always ready to be filled in. Climate strike Fridays, women's marches, and Black Lives Matter content all use it.

Picket lines and union organizing — especially after the wave of 2023 labor actions — gave it constant fresh relevance.
